Shimla: Tutikandi bus terminus gets final notice over Rs 6.3 cr property tax
Shimla, July 10
The Shimla Municipal Corporation has issued a final notice to the management of the Interstate Bus Terminus (ISBT), Tutikandi, over non-payment of the property tax amounting to Rs 6.33 crore, asking it to clear the pending dues within two weeks.
The corporation has warned the ISBT management that water and electricity connections would be cut if it failed to deposit the property tax before within the given timeframe.
According to the corporation, despite several notices the ISBT management is yet to deposit the property tax. The ISBT building houses several eateries, a multiplex, shops and hotels, besides the interstate bus stand itself.
Shimla Municipal Corporation Commissioner Bhupinder Attri said a final notice had been issued to the ISBT management over the non-payment of the property tax. He said strict action would be taken against the management, as per the rules, if it failed to deposit the tax on time.
Meanwhile, the civic body has also issued property tax bills to more than 27,000 building owners in the town. The last date for depositing the tax is July 31. The bills were to be issued earlier this year, but the process was delayed as most MC employees were busy in the poll duties. The MC had decided to extend the last date of depositing the property.
